Starting Lineup: 2021 NCS NASCAR All-Star Race at Texas Motor Speedway

Kyle Larson and Kyle Busch are set to start on the front row for Sunday Night’s NASCAR All-Star Race at Texas Motor Speedway, the first-ever at the 1.5-mile facility. Christopher Bell, Cole Custer and Austin Dillon will round out the top-five starters for the event.
